True or False: Health and Productivity Management (HPM) is more extensive than IDM and TAM.

True

Health and Productivity Management (HPM) is indeed more extensive than Integrated Disability Management (IDM) and Total Absence Management (TAM). HPM takes a broader approach by encompassing various aspects of employee health, well-being, and productivity, including prevention strategies, wellness initiatives, and the overall health care management of employees.

In contrast, IDM and TAM focus more specifically on managing disability cases and absence from work. IDM integrates different areas such as health care, occupational health, and disability management to facilitate the return of employees to work. TAM primarily emphasizes managing absence and improving attendance without necessarily addressing the wider health management strategies that HPM encompasses.

The comprehensive nature of HPM allows organizations to foster an environment that enhances both employee wellness and productivity, recognizing that these factors are interlinked and crucial for organizational success. Therefore, the assertion that HPM is more extensive is accurate and reflects the multifaceted approach that HPM advocates in managing employee health and productivity.
